Intendant \In*tend"ant\, n. [F. intendant, fr. L. intendere to
direct (one's thoughts) to a thing. See {Intend}.]
One who has the charge, direction, or management of some
public business; a superintendent; as, an intendant of
marine; an intendant of finance.
[1913 Webster]


Intendant \In*tend"ant\, a. [See {Intend}.]
Attentive. [Obs.]
[1913 Webster]

    Intendants were royal civil servants in France under the Old Regime A product of the centralization policies of the French crown, intendants were appointed "commissions," and not purchasable hereditary "offices," which thus prevented the abuse of sales of royal offices and made them more tractable and subservient emissaries of the king

    Intendant, administrative official under the ancien régime in France who served as an agent of the king in each of the provinces, or généralités From about 1640 until 1789, the intendancies were the chief instrument used to achieve administrative unification and centralization under the French
